Transaction bd77a5c3e60edf1e523a7b83623d03a3bffe8b3fc1ec29aa0de29d8adf751c74
1 Input
1 Output
-
bd77a5c3e60edf1e523a7b83623d03a3bffe8b3fc1ec29aa0de29d8adf751c74:0
- value
- 530301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ba77a513eb3ff08230ec5864354a1761ff15824 OP_EQUAL
- address
- 3Ft3HqdDThrunNkNbNfHNTprh5mUArsEi7